About The Position

Southall is a premier destination bringing nature, produce and people together in a powerful and unique way. The Director of Finance is responsible for directing all aspects of accounting/administration for a development and operation of a small luxury rural farm resort in accordance to county regulations; responsible for planning, managing, and supporting the achievement of revenue and income objectives, market share, and customer service objectives; establishes departmental policies and procedures; develops and monitors all departmental budgets to ensure their profitable operation. Management functions within General & Administrative include Accounting, Finance, Information Systems, Purchasing, Receiving, Night Audit and Credit. This position will have considerable responsibility - leading all financial/accounting aspects of Southall as outlined herein. Successful delivery of all key aspects within the Director of Finances sphere will help ensure Southalls Mission, future profitability, and sustainability.

Responsibilities

  • Strategically run Finance and Accounting to help move the Southall Mission forward -while protecting all Mission/Vision stakeholders
  • Create Budgets and Forecasts - and manage those financial tools - in order to successfully realize and sustain this premier development
  • Build financial reports monthly/quarterly/annually to drive higher profitability: Balance Sheet Cast Forecast/ Reconcile account balances Income Statements Accounts Receivable Accounts Payables Payroll Tax Preparation needs
  • Collaborate and plan for successful, efficient Audit reporting
  • Management of Controllers Checklists
  • Establish and lead Inventory Control Systems
  • Establish and assist leading Purchasing procedures / Turn ratios and days available for major asset categories and compare to standards (Big 4, retail, uniforms, guest supplies, etc.)
  • Preparation of Tax requirements and knowledge of county, state taxes and laws with innkeepers, liquor and labor
  • Oversee all pertinent leases, contracts, agreements, covenants, and restrictions and ensure Southall interests are protected
  • Oversee Accounting software to integrate with Property Management Syste
  • Maintain various financial databases and reports
  • Evaluate productivity and departmental performance
  • Lead performance reviews and performance management of AP/Payroll and AR/Credit, IT, and Purchasing team
